More than half of the survey respondents (58 per cent) are unable to pronounce the ingredients in the foods they buy regularly. To help consumers make healthy choices Maple Leaf ensured that each variety of Natural Selections deli meat – oven-roasted turkey, oven-roasted chicken, baked deli ham and black forest ham – has no more than nine easy-to-recognize ingredients.
Consumers are responding positively to the back-to-basics trend and are seeking out products made with natural ingredients to feed their families. In fact, about one in four Canadians (27 per cent) only buy products made with natural ingredients. Food labels on everyday products are becoming easier to read and the ingredients are even easier to pronounce.
We want to provide our customers with foods free of added preservatives and artificial ingredients they can feel good about feeding their families," said David Grachnik, Marketing Manager for Natural Selections. "So we launched Natural Selections by Maple Leaf, made with our finest cuts of meat plus simple, pronounceable ingredients like vinegar, lemon and sea salt."
